Juvenile Verdin
Gilbert, AZ A locally common bird but a tough one to photograph, they are very small and hyperactive! This is my best effort so far, but I intend to keep working on it. The adult has a yellow head. Canon D30, 500 with 1.4x, tripod, cropped about 20%. Cindy Marple
